'Parichay sammelan' organised

The Vaishya Sewa Samiti organised 'prospective partners parichay sammelan' at the Ghanta Ghar Ram Lila Maidan here, in a bid to help people find their life partners.
At the programme, Pankaj Singh, BJP's Uttar Pradesh state general secretary and son of Union Home Minister Rajnath Singh, said such programmed would help eradicate the menace of dowry.
V K Aggarwal of the samiti said as many as 38 marriages have been settled in the sammelan this year, and that the organisation will help financially to the parents of poor girls in solemnising their marriage.
A total of 950 boys and girls got their names registered for the two-day 'parichay sammelan', he said.
